ROME -- Mario Balotelli scored twice and also hit the crossbar but AC Milan still had to scramble for a 2-2 draw at promoted Livorno in the Serie A on Saturday. Also, Napoli surrendered the lead twice in a 3-3 draw with Udinese and wasted a chance to pull level with second-place Roma. In Livorno, Balotelli put Milan ahead seven minutes in after redirecting a cross from Kaka then scored the equalizer in the 82nd with a splendid free kick over a Livorno wall. Balotelli nearly produced a winner in the 89th but his long-distance effort banged off the underside of the crossbar and bounced in front of the goal. Livornos Luca Siligardi made it 1-1 in the 26th with a shot from beyond the area and Paulinho put the hosts ahead in the 58th by finishing off a counterattack. Milan moved into eighth place while Livorno moved to fifth from bottom. Balotelli has scored four goals in his last three matches after a six-match scoreless streak in all competitions. "Ive always been fine. There were never any big problems like was written," Balotelli said. "We were just lacking some goals. ... And we need to be more attentive when our opponents go on counterattacks." Milans next match is versus Ajax on Wednesday at the San Siro in the Champions League. Napoli also has a key European match on Wednesday against Arsenal. At the San Paolo stadium, Goran Pandev scored for Napoli in the 38th and 41st. First, the Macedonia striker was set up by Federico Fernandez then for his second he took a pass from Gonzalo Higuain and shot between a defenders legs. Udinese pulled one back in the 45th with an own goal from Fernandez, who was attempting to block a header from Thomas Heurtaux, then Portuguese midfielder Bruno Fernandes equalized with a long lob in the 70th that caught Napoli goalkeeper Rafael out of position. Blerim Dzemaili restored Napolis lead a minute later, knocking in a rebound of a shot from Higuain, and Dusan Basta took advantage as Napolis defenders stood idle to equalize in the 80th from close range. The Ultimate Fighting Championship and Strikeforce announced on Tuesday that all athletes will be tested for performance enhancing drugs before they sign contracts, something a Canadian expert on testing suggests is useless. The two U.S.-based mixed martial arts organizations, both owned by Zuffa LLC, say the policy took effect Jan. 1. "Were committed to the health and safety of our athletes and we take it very seriously," UFC chairman Lorenzo Fertitta said in announcing the new policy. But the announcement is just window dressing, suggests Dick Pound, a Montreal-based lawyer and former president of the World Anti-Doping Agency. "Its complete illusory and obviously intended to be that way," he said with a laugh. "The minute you know when youll be tested, its very easy to make sure you dont test positive." The only way to really test athletes is to have a random drug testing program 365 days a year so that they cannot prepare, he said. "Theyre just trying to do enough to keep the Congress off their backs," he said of the MMA announcement. Zuffas new testing plan comes as former Strikeforce light heavyweight champion Muhammed (King Mo) Lawal tested positive for the steroid Drostanolone, according to the Nevada Athletic Commission. If that decision stands, he faces a suspension, fine and would lose the win he scored over Lorrenzo Larkin at the Jan.dddddddddddd 7 Strikeforce event where the tests were conducted. He has denied he took any prohibited substances on various MMA fan websites. Strikeforce CEO Scott Coker said in a statement that his organization has a "strict, consistent policy" regarding performance enhancing drugs and that athletes in his organization are tested. "Therefore, we fully support the drug testing efforts of the Nevada State Athletic Commission, and we will fully cooperate with the Commission regarding the matter pertaining to Mr. Lawals test," Coker said. "We also recognize that Mr. Lawal has administrative process rights under Nevada law, and we hope that he is not prejudged before exercising such rights." Keith Kizer, executive director of the Nevada Athletic Commission, said tests also were conducted on other fighters as well at the Jan. 7 event. Those included Luke Rockhold, Keith Jardine, Robbie Lawler, Tyron Woodley, Tarec Saffiedine, Tyler Stinson, Nah-Shon Burrell, James Terry, Gian Villante, Trevor Smith, Ricky Legere, Chris Spang, Estevan Payan and Alonzo Martinez. All came back negative, except for Lawals test. Drostanolone, also known as dromostanolone, Drolban or Masteron, is prescribed for high cholesterol as well as an aid in the treatment of some cancers.
